Ever wished you could jot down a task and set up a reminder alert really, really fast? Yeah, we do too.

The beauty of Due lies in its simplicity. There's no account to create, no start or end date to set, no need to prioritize, tag nor categorize.

What there is however are what that matters: a note for your reminder and an alert that is set up in mere seconds.

★ FEATURES ★

✓ Super fast
Set up a reminder with alert up to 3x faster than the stock Calendar or Reminder app

✓ Get to the timings you need in a tap
Bring that file before leaving home in the morning? Return a call at lunch time? With 4 preset and customizable timings, you'll be zipping through the time wheel and getting to what you want in a tap

✓ Create reminders based on your calendar events from compatible third-party apps such as Agenda app or Week Calendar and have Due send you right back to where you left off

✓ Reusable countdown, egg timers
Precise to the second, they are perfect for timing your soft-boiled eggs, coffee brewing and tea steeping. Set them up once and reuse them forever

✓ Keep track of outstanding tasks with Smart Badges
See at a glance how many tasks you have for the day, or only those you've ignored or missed, or turn off badging if you don't want any

✓ Never miss any reminders with auto snooze
Repeatedly notifies you of missed reminders until marked done or rescheduled

✓ Reschedule and defer reminders quickly

✓ Powerful recurring reminders
Vitamins before bed each night? Pay rent every 2 weeks on Monday? Submit a report on the last weekday of the month? Yup.

✓ Natural date and time parsing
Create reminders with due date filled in automatically by typing into the title directly eg. Wash the dishes in 30 mins, Leave for badminton at 3pm on Friday

✓ Track past reminders and quickly create new ones based on expired reminders within the Logbook

✓ Time Zone Shifting
Receive timely reminders no matter where you are in the world

✓ 12 great sounding alerts of varying lengths to choose from

✓ Universal app, looks and works great on both iPhone and iPad

✓ Keep reminders in sync across your iPhone and iPad with OTA Sync via iCloud or Dropbox

✓ Backup, email and restore databases

✓ Undo and redo

✓ Assignable alert sounds
Assign distinctive alert sound for each reminder; louder and longer ones for important reminders, and subtler ones for less critical reminders.

✓ Reliable reminders that don't require any Internet connection

✓ Save 20% of your battery life compared with apps using Push notifications

✓ Fully localized for English, Deutsch, 日本語, Italiano, Nederlands, Español, Français, Polski, Русский, 한국어, العربية, Português brasileiro, Dansk, Svenska, Norsk (bokmål), 简体中文, 繁體中文

ver. 1.8.3 (15-09-2010) ★ CHANGES & FIXES IN 1.8.3 ★

Fixes crash on launch for iPad running iOS 4.

★ CHANGES & FIXES IN 1.8.2 ★

- iCloud-sync stability and fixes
- Now prompts to open a troubleshooting guide when iCloud sync goes wrong
- Added a Troubleshooting button to Settings > Sync when syncing via iCloud
- Now terminates upload for iCloud immediately when there's no network connection instead of waiting for time out
- Reduce unnecessary prompting about whether changes to recurring reminders should be applied to all future occurrences for certain daily and weekly reminders
- Error messages in the info bar are now positioned more conspicuously at the top of the reminders list on the iPad
- Fixes bug in iOS 5 where overdue reminders sometimes lose their notifications even though they are set to auto-snooze or recur
- Fixes bug where we try to sync unnecessarily with a database that we are trying to upload, but has not been uploaded due to the upload timing out
- Fixes bug where editing recurring reminders sometimes do not show the option to apply the changes to all future occurrences
- Fixes an embarrassing grammatical error when saving a reminder with a due date in the past. '[date] has past.' is now '[date] is in the past.' (thanks @ordnance_elf)
- Fixes bug where rotating your iPad with a info bar showing at the top results in the bar being mispositioned after rotation
- Fixes crash on iPad when dismissing the iOS 5 upgrade note with action menu still opened
- Fixes bug where iCloud sync is not unlinked from Due if user turns off iCloud or Documents in the Cloud and then resumes Due from background
- Fixes possible lag on launch with iCloud sync enabled when transiting between areas with network connectivity and areas without
- Fixes bug where the sync progress gets stuck if 'Sync at launch' is not checked when Due detects an update over iCloud and attempts to download it for syncing
- Fixes bug where the download status bar flickers just before sync occurs when Due detects and downloads an update from iCloud over cellular data connection
- Fixes bug where timer editor shows a parsing button erroneously
- Fixes bug where tapping on a settings cell does not change the color of the labels to white when the cell is highlighted

★ WHAT'S NEW IN 1.8–1.8.1 ★

✓ iCloud sync

Keep your data in sync across your iPhone and iPad through iCloud.

✓ Improved Dropbox sync

Sync database on Dropbox can now be moved to another location of your choice within your Dropbox folder.

✓ Assignable alert tones

Assign a distinctive alert sound for each reminder. Shows the last two most recently used alert sound for quick access to frequently used alert sounds.

✓ Retina-display graphics for the new iPad

✓ Two brand new short alert sounds

✓ Duplicate reminders
Create reminders quickly based on the time and recurrence of existing reminders. Now easier to create a series of reminders at different hours of day (eg. 3 doses of medicine daily).

✓ Updated date and time parsing behavior
Tap on title bar to parse date. Due no longer sets the due date and time automatically when typing in the title, and no longer prompts to remove/keep parsed date in title on saving/dismissing of keyboard.

✓ Easier to modify recurring reminders now
Due now asks if changes should be applied to just the next occurrence, or to all future events when editing recurring reminders.
